Coenzyme Q10, an essential antioxidant for our body to fight against oxidative stress.

Coenzyme Q10, naturally present in all our cells, is an essential compound for the production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the molecule that generates 95% of the human body's energy.

Closely related to vitamin K and a very powerful antioxidant, it activates the energy production necessary for the normal functioning of our body, protects our cardiovascular and immune systems, and slows down skin aging, notably by helping to fight against free radicals and oxidative stress.

To learn more - Free radicals, oxidative stress, and antioxidants, what exactly is it?

Our cells are true little energy power plants. Cellular metabolism, thanks to the oxidation-reduction mechanism, involves a transfer of electrons between the oxygen molecules we breathe and the glucose molecules or certain fatty acids from our diet (carbohydrates and lipids respectively). By capturing pairs of electrons from them, oxygen allows the transformation of these nutrients into ATP (adenosine triphosphate), the cellular fuel, in other words, the energy necessary for the normal functioning of our body.

Any energy production cannot be 100% optimal and inevitably produces waste. Indeed, during cellular oxidation-reduction processes, a percentage of these exchanges do not happen as they should, and a certain number of oxygen molecules end up with an odd number of electrons. These reactive and unstable oxygen derivatives are called free radicals. Thus, the oxygen necessary for the life of our organism can also become its enemy and accelerate its wear and tear.

As any unstable element seeks to balance itself, free radicals draw the electron they lack from their environment. They then destabilize the cells, blood cells, proteins, or even microbes they encounter. Admittedly, this natural process is beneficial for our immune defenses, but an excess of free radicals causes chain disruptions that directly affect our health.

Produced in small quantities, free radicals are well managed by our body thanks to the production of antioxidants. The antioxidants present in our organism, mostly coming from an appropriate diet rich in fruits and vegetables, are molecules that neutralize free radicals and allow a balance between the two. In this case, they are beneficial for our health: they ensure the cleansing of our body by eliminating old or defective cells. They also intervene in the antibacterial, microbial, and viral fight and participate in proper immune functioning.

However, our new lifestyles are the origin of an excess production of free radicals, under the effect of numerous factors:

  • external: water and air pollution, tobacco smoke, sun UV rays, radiation, etc.;
  • internal: medications, alcohol, tobacco, industrial food;
  • lifestyle: sleep deficit, excess or lack of physical exercise, overwork, etc.;
  • stressful environment: overwork, stress, anxiety, negative emotional states.

Produced in too large a quantity, free radicals cause what is called oxidative stress or oxidative stress. Our cells (including the DNA present in them) oxidize, deteriorate, and die. If our body does not have enough antioxidants acting as shields against free radicals, oxidative stress leads to the premature aging of our cells and increases the risk of developing certain degenerative diseases (such as cancers, etc.), neurodegenerative, inflammatory, cardiovascular, diabetes...

Antioxidants, capable of reducing or even preventing the oxidation process of our cells by free radicals, are essential to protect us from oxidative stress and its devastating effects on the health of our cells, organs, and skin.
